1. Dimension 1 — Consumables
High usage, low cost → must stock enough
These are used every day.
You should keep 3–6 months of stock on site.
✅ Key Consumables
- Oscillating blades
Different materials need different blade types.
Ask your supplier for the correct model before stocking. - Cutting mats / underlay sheets
Normal lifetime: about 1 year
Prepare at least 1 spare to avoid downtime.
Simple rule:
Weekly usage × 12–24 weeks = Correct purchase quantity

2. Dimension 2 — Wear Parts
Medium cost, predictable replacement cycle
These parts last longer but will wear out after continuous use.
🔧 Key Wear Parts
- Lubricating oil / low-density pneumatic oil
Used on pneumatic oscillating tools - Bearings inside high-speed tools
(High-frequency EOT / Milling spindle) - Belts
Especially W-axis rotary belts - Blade holders and screws
Small parts that must always remain tight and secure

🛠️ Tip:
Replace before failure → avoids emergency shutdown
| Wear Part | Expected Lifetime | Recommendation |
|---|---|---|
| Blade holder screws | 3–6 months | Keep 10–20 pcs |
| High-frequency tool bearings | 6–12 months | Replace yearly |
| Pneumatic oil | Monthly | Always in stock |
| W-axis belt | 12–18 months | 1 spare per machine |
3. Dimension 3 — Critical Components
Low failure rate, but high risk
If one fails → Production stops immediately.
🚨 High-Priority Spare Parts
- Limit switches / sensors
(We recommend Omron brand) - Servo motor encoder cables
- Control relays and fuses
- Vacuum solenoid valves
- Pneumatic regulators and connectors
- Oscillating knife cutting tool assemblies
(Having one ready saves days of downtime)
⚠️ Just one broken sensor can shut down your 50,000 USD machine.
✅ Always keep at least 1 spare of each critical part

4. How Many Spares Do YOU Need?
Spare kit size depends on usage level:
| Factory Type | Spare Strategy |
|---|---|
| Small batch / Low usage | 1–2 months consumables + basic wear parts |
| Medium factory | 3–6 months consumables + full wear part set |
| High-volume / 24/7 production | Full spare kit + backup critical parts |
If your delivery time matters → your spares must be ready.
